''The capital city is Quito, while the largest city is Guayaquil.

In reflection of the country's rich cultural heritage, the historical center of Quito was declared a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1978.


''
*Ecuador has largest boundary with Peru   which is approximately 1420  km.
*Ecuador has shortest boundary with Colombia   which is approximately 590  km.
*The largest river in Ecuador is Içá  which is 1570 km.
*The largest export partner of Ecuador is US.
*The largest import partner of Ecuador is US.
*There are 13 seaports in Ecuador.

!!National Facts
*The national bird of Ecuador is Andean condor.
*Rose is the national flower of Ecuador.
* The famous dance of Ecuador is Sanjuanito.
* The famous dishes of Ecuador are Encebollado, Fritada, Guatitas, Ceviche etc.
